@charset "UTF-8";@media (min-width:992px) and (max-width:1199px){.menu-bar{display:flex;justify-content:end;align-items:center;height:100%;text-align:end;cursor:pointer}.menu-bar i{font-size:36px;color:#000}}@media (max-width:1600px){.about-head .title{font-size:14px}.about-head .btn{padding:10px 30px}}@media (max-width:991px){.bar-menu{display:flex;align-items:center;justify-content:end;height:100%;margin:0}.nav-wrapper{position:absolute;width:50%;height:100vh;transition:transform .3s;transform:translateX(-100%);left:0;top:0;z-index:999}.nav-wrapper.show-menu{transform:none}.js-nav-toggle{position:relative;top:0;right:0;width:43px;height:40px;display:block;float:right;padding:0;color:#345;border:2px solid #345;z-index:2}.js-nav-toggle span{position:relative;background-color:#345;height:2px;display:block;width:22px;margin:17px auto 0;transition:all .4s;transition-delay:.3s}.js-nav-toggle span:before,.js-nav-toggle span:after{content:"";position:absolute;display:block;width:20px;height:0;left:1px;top:50%;margin-top:-7px;transition:all .3s .3s}.js-nav-toggle span:before{box-shadow:0 14px 0 1px #345}.js-nav-toggle span:after{box-shadow:0 0 0 1px #345}.close-menu .js-nav-toggle span{background-color:transparent;transition:all .3s ease}.close-menu .js-nav-toggle span:before{transform:rotate(-45deg)}.close-menu .js-nav-toggle span:after{transform:rotate(45deg)}.close-menu .js-nav-toggle span:before,.close-menu .js-nav-toggle span:after{margin-top:0;box-shadow:0 0 0 1px #345;transition:all .3s ease}nav .nav-toggle{position:absolute;top:0;left:0;width:100%;padding:.45em .6em;background-color:#000;color:#fff;z-index:100;cursor:pointer;transition:backgroun-color .2s}nav .nav-toggle:hover{background-color:#ff8a00}nav .nav-toggle.back-visible .nav-back{opacity:1}nav .nav-toggle.back-visible .nav-title{transform:translateX(40px)}nav .nav-title{position:absolute;left:0;top:.8em;padding-left:.7em;transition:transform .3s}nav .nav-back{display:inline-block;position:relative;width:30px;height:30px;vertical-align:middle;z-index:1;opacity:0;transition:opacity .2s}nav .nav-back:before,nav .nav-back:after{content:"";position:absolute;top:50%}nav .nav-back:before{left:50%;width:9px;height:9px;border:2px solid currentcolor;border-right-color:transparent;border-bottom-color:transparent;transform:translate(-50%,-50%) rotateZ(-45deg)}nav .nav-back:after{left:28%;width:15px;height:2px;background-color:currentcolor;margin-top:-1px}nav li.has-dropdown>a{padding-right:2.5em;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}nav li.has-dropdown>a:after{content:"";position:absolute;top:50%;right:30px;width:9px;height:9px;border:1px solid currentcolor;border-left-color:transparent;border-top-color:transparent;transform:translateY(-90%) rotateZ(-45deg);transition:transform .3s;transform-origin:100%}nav li.nav-dropdown-open ul{display:block}}@media (min-width:768px) and (max-width:991px){.menu-bar{display:flex;justify-content:end;align-items:center;height:100%;text-align:end;cursor:pointer}.menu-bar i{font-size:36px;color:#000}.first-header .social-details ul li a{font-size:11px}}@media (max-width:767px){.first-header .social-details ul{justify-content:center}.first-header .social-icons ul{justify-content:center;padding:10px 0}.tab-bar-about .tablinks{padding:15px;font-size:14px;white-space:nowrap;column-gap:10px}.menu-bar{display:flex;justify-content:end;align-items:center;height:100%;text-align:end;cursor:pointer}.menu-bar i{font-size:36px;color:#000}.main-btn a{display:inline-block}.health-trips-box .health-contant{padding:15px 0}.lightbox-gallery{margin:10px 0}.side-bar-section{margin:20px 0}.heading-page p{font-size:12px;line-height:20px}.right-sidebar-section .cantant-sidebar p{font-size:14px;line-height:25px}.heading-page h3{font-size:30px}.benefits-endoscopy-content ul{column-count:1}.procedures-endoscopy .card-endoscopy{height:auto;margin-bottom:15px}.surgery-homepage li{margin-bottom:10px}}@media (max-width:480px){.tab-bar-about .tablinks{font-size:12px;margin:0 2px}.first-header .social-details ul li a{font-size:10px}.nav-wrapper{width:70%}#slider .item .slider-section .slider-contant .leftside-img{width:80px;height:80px}#slider .item .slider-section .slider-contant .text-slider{width:100%;margin-top:1rem}#slider .item .slider-section .slider-contant .text-slider h3{font-size:calc(1.3rem + .6vw)}#slider .item .slider-section .slider-contant .text-slider h4{font-size:1rem}#slider .item .slider-section .slider-contant .text-slider p{font-size:1rem}.fixed-navbar{top:5.7em}.fixed-navbar.sticky{top:0;border-bottom:2px solid #115949}.about-doctor-details .details-doctor h4 span{font-size:14px}.contact-appointmant .contact-details-home ul li a{font-size:14px}.contact-appointmant .contact-details-home ul li{border-bottom:1px solid #ddd;padding-bottom:10px}.contact-appointmant .contact-details-home ul li:last-child{border-bottom:0}.contact-appointmant .appointment-time ul li{font-size:14px}.main-header .sec-header .logo-header img{height:40px}.tab-bar-about-slide{overflow-x:auto;margin-bottom:10px}.appoitnment-seo h2{font-size:25px;line-height:30px}.appoitnment-seo p{font-size:14px}.appoitnment-seo{margin-top:0;margin-bottom:0}.news-block .lower-content{padding:0}.fixed-header .mobile-header{position:fixed;right:0;left:0;top:0;background:#fff;border-bottom:2px solid #115949;transition:.3s}.Medical-Facilities-points ul{column-count:unset}.about-clinic .head-content{padding:0;background:0 0;overflow:unset}.Super-Speciality ul{column-count:unset}.Super-Speciality.sub-heading{margin-bottom:0}.Super-Speciality ul li{line-height:50px}.Medical-Facilities-points ul li{font-size:12px}.contant-main-page h1{font-size:25px}.contant-main-page h2{font-size:20px}.contact-us-head{height:450px!important}.contact-section blockquote{margin-top:0;margin-bottom:0}.contact-section ul{column-count:unset}.what-gastro-content ul{flex-wrap:wrap}.what-gastro-content ul li{margin:0;margin-bottom:15px}.what-gastro-content ul li:last-child{margin-bottom:0}.conditions-gastroenterologist .conditions-gastro-content ul{column-count:1}.blog-post blockquote{margin:10px 5px;padding:20px 15px}.sidebar-page-container .sidebar{margin-left:0;margin-bottom:50px}.help-box p,.brochures-box .text{font-size:16px}}